Olivia Duan Atlanta, Georgia

Address: 711 Techwood Dr NW, Atlanta 30313, GA

Age: 27

Olivia Duan Suwanee, Georgia

Address: 11197 Peachcove Ct, Suwanee 30024, GA

Age: 29

Phone: (770) 232-0711

